Most not too long ago, it has been discovered that conolidine and the above derivatives act about the atypical chemokine receptor 3 (ACKR3. Expressed in similar spots as classical opioid receptors, it binds to your big range of endogenous opioids. Unlike most opioid receptors, this receptor acts as a scavenger and doesn't activate a next messenger technique (fifty nine). As talked about by Meyrath et al., this also indicated a probable hyperlink in between these receptors and the endogenous opiate program (59). This study ultimately identified that the ACKR3 receptor did not generate any G protein sign response by measuring and getting no mini G protein interactions, unlike classical opiate receptors, which recruit these proteins for signaling.

Particularly, conolidine is undoubtedly an indole alkaloid that originates from the bark on the Tabernaemontana divaricata plant, a tropical flowering shrub. The Tabernaemontana divaricata plant has a long history of use in standard drugs tactics all through Asia – including in traditional Chinese and Thai medication methods As well as in Ayurveda.
